Look at the Scoreboard – Emma Stewart is the Greatest Trainer Australia of 2 and 3-Year-Old Pacers That the World Has Ever Seen

The all conquering Emma Steward stable had 14 runners across five Group races for 2 and 3-year-old pacers run at Bendigo last night. Fiver were in the Victorian Oaks. They finished 1-2-3-5-7. Four were in the Derby. They ran 1-3-4-11. Three were in the 2YO Home Grown Classic for fillies. They finished 1-2-3. The remaining […]
